2 sticks butter, softened
½ c. Crisco shortening
3 c. sugar
5 eggs
1 c. 7 Up
3 c. flour
1-1/2 t. vanilla
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Cream butter, shortening and sugar with electric mixer. Add eggs one at a time, beating well after each addition; add vanilla. Alternate the dry ingredients with the 7 Up and beat until well blended. Bake in a greased and floured bundt pan for 1 hour. Do not overbake or cake will be dry. Cool pan on wire rack for 10 minutes then invert onto a cake platter.
OPTIONAL GLAZE:
½ c. sugar
¼ c. 7 Up
While cake is cooling, make the glaze by stirring together the 7 Up and sugar in a saucepan. Bring to a boil over medium heat and boil 1-2 minutes or until sugar is completely dissolved. Punch holes in the top of the warm cake with a toothpick. Spoon glaze over the cake and cool completely before serving.
